🗣 Wd提问: vps怎么安装防火墙
🤖 Ai回答: 安装防火墙在虚拟专用服务器(VPS)上可以提高安全性,防止未经授权的访问和攻击。以下是一个基本步骤来安装和配置防火墙:
1、安装防火墙软件
首先,你需要选择一个适合你的操作系统(通常是Linux发行版)的防火墙软件。常见的有:
iptables:适用于大多数基于Debian/Ubuntu的系统。
firewalld:适用于Fedora、CentOS等系统。
使用 `iptables` 配置防火墙
bash
sudo apt-get update
sudo apt-get install iptables
使用 `firewalld` 配置防火墙
bash
sudo yum install firewalld
sudo systemctl enable firewalld
sudo systemctl start firewalld
2、配置防火墙规则
根据你的需求设置防火墙规则。例如,如果你想要允许HTTP和HTTPS流量,你可以这样做:
使用 `iptables` 配置防火墙
bash
sudo ufw allow 'Apache HTTP'
或者更具体地:
bash
sudo ufw allow 'Apache HTTP (80/tcp)'
sudo ufw allow 'Apache HTTPS (443/tcp)'
使用 `firewalld` 配置防火墙
bash
sudo firewall-cmd permanent add-service=http
sudo firewall-cmd permanent add-service=https
sudo firewall-cmd reload
3、测试防火墙规则
确保你的防火墙规则已经生效,并且没有阻止必要的服务。
使用 `iptables` 测试防火墙
bash
sudo ufw status
使用 `firewalld` 测试防火墙
bash
sudo firewall-cmd list-all-services
4、定期更新和监控
定期检查防火墙日志以确保一切正常,并根据需要调整规则。
注意事项
确保你了解你正在使用的防火墙软件的功能和限制。
在生产环境中使用防火墙时,请确保你理解其配置对网络性能的影响。
对于复杂的防火墙配置,建议查阅官方文档或寻求专业帮助。
通过以上步骤,你应该能够为你的VPS安装并配置一个基本的防火墙。
📣 商家广告:





0
IP地址: 75.115.97.140
搜索次数: 9
提问时间: 2025-12-14 14:48:56
本站所有
❓
问答
均由Ai自动分析整理,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。
本站由
🟢
豌豆Ai
提供技术支持,使用的最新版:
豌豆Ai站群搜索引擎系统 V.25.10.25
搭建本站。